Output 809574a81866a01f59a44eef62d2e2db325b9de525aad6f5b295ffbe4d4eec87:9

value
798595
script pubkey
OP_0 OP_PUSHBYTES_20 50e6149a47bbf3310016ae916a8392983f372557
address
bc1q2rnpfxj8h0enzqqk46gk4qujnqlnwf2hv2uvyg
transaction
809574a81866a01f59a44eef62d2e2db325b9de525aad6f5b295ffbe4d4eec87
confirmations
215542
spent
true